Package Details: dolphin-emu-git 2412.r166.g90eba2b1a0-1

Git Clone URL: https://aur.archlinux.org/dolphin-emu-git.git (read-only, click to copy)
Package Base: dolphin-emu-git
Description: A Gamecube / Wii emulator - git version
Upstream URL: https://dolphin-emu.org
Keywords: dolphin emu emulator game gamecube gui nintendo remote revolution triforce wii wiimote
Licenses: GPL-2.0-or-later
Conflicts: dolphin-emu
Provides: dolphin-emu
Submitter: None
Maintainer: dpeukert
Last Packager: dpeukert
Votes: 123
Popularity: 0.30
First Submitted: 2011-08-20 13:05 (UTC)
Last Updated: 2025-01-19 23:35 (UTC)

Dependencies (53)

Required by (3)

Sources (9)

Pinned Comments

dpeukert commented on 2020-04-10 12:34 (UTC) (edited on 2020-09-26 17:48 (UTC) by dpeukert)

The PKGBUILD for this package is hosted here (contributions are welcome!): https://gitlab.com/dpeukert/pkgbuilds/tree/main/dolphin-emu-git

Latest Comments

« First ‹ Previous 1 2 3 4 5 6 7 8 9 10 11 .. 58 Next › Last »

tuxpenguin commented on 2024-06-24 04:54 (UTC)

Can the zlib-ng dependency be made to give the option between zlib-ng and zlib with zlib-ng being the default? Artix currently doesn't package zlib-ng however I don't see why zlib can't optionally be used over zlib-ng.

hawaka commented on 2024-06-24 00:06 (UTC)

@xAsh Just uninstall "dolphin-emu-git". Update "ffmpeg" than install "dolphin-emu-git". It will build against the new version of "ffmpeg" (unless support hasn't been added upstream).

xAsh commented on 2024-06-23 11:00 (UTC) (edited on 2024-06-23 11:00 (UTC) by xAsh)

Unable to update ffmpeg because of this package:

installing ffmpeg (2:7.0.1-1) breaks dependency 'libavcodec.so=60-64' required by dolphin-emu-git
installing ffmpeg (2:7.0.1-1) breaks dependency 'libavformat.so=60-64' required by dolphin-emu-git
installing ffmpeg (2:7.0.1-1) breaks dependency 'libavutil.so=58-64' required by dolphin-emu-git
installing ffmpeg (2:7.0.1-1) breaks dependency 'libswscale.so=7-64' required by dolphin-emu-git

dpeukert commented on 2024-05-28 23:55 (UTC)

@JoshuaVandaele: This should now be fixed, thanks for the report.

JoshuaVandaele commented on 2024-05-26 13:15 (UTC)

It appears this package is broken: Ever since last week, trying to install it (cleanly) using makepkg --si yields this build error:

CMake Error at Externals/minizip-ng/CMakeLists.txt:3 (add_library):
  Cannot find source file:

    minizip-ng/mz.h

  Tried extensions .c .C .c++ .cc .cpp .cxx .cu .mpp .m .M .mm .ixx .cppm
  .ccm .cxxm .c++m .h .hh .h++ .hm .hpp .hxx .in .txx .f .F .for .f77 .f90
  .f95 .f03 .hip .ispc


CMake Error at Externals/minizip-ng/CMakeLists.txt:3 (add_library):
  No SOURCES given to target: minizip

This also happens in a fresh install inside a virtual machine. However, I am able to build from source following the instructions at https://github.com/dolphin-emu/dolphin/wiki/Building-for-Linux

xiota commented on 2024-05-09 09:36 (UTC) (edited on 2024-05-09 10:03 (UTC) by xiota)

@willianholtz Consider using the package in extra as long as it is working. A while ago, there were issues with segfault when loading roms, as you describe. It was fixed, but possibly returned.

Last time it happened, the cause was LTO. But the package has LTO disabled. I also rebuilt it and am unable to reproduce your issue. However, on some machines, with some other packages, there have been issues where LTO appears to be enabled even though the package has it disabled. I don't know the cause.

dpeukert commented on 2024-05-09 09:36 (UTC)

@xiota: Feel free to build this package with --nocheck if you feel it doesn't add any value. Of course loading an actual ROM would be better, but given the things Nintendo has been up to lately, I'd rather not do that.

dpeukert commented on 2024-05-09 09:32 (UTC) (edited on 2024-05-09 09:36 (UTC) by dpeukert)

@mkopec: That looks like a solution, I still think that behaviour should be enabled by upstream by default when running the nogui binary, but there's no reason not to include since it fixes the problem on our side. I'll add it when I get home tonight.

xiota commented on 2024-05-09 09:31 (UTC)

That command is kind of pointless and causes more problems than it prevents because segfaults when printing the version aren't that common. More common are problems loading actual roms.

mkopec commented on 2024-05-09 09:28 (UTC) (edited on 2024-05-09 09:28 (UTC) by mkopec)

@dpeukert: WDYT about running the tests with QT_QPA_PLATFORM=offscreen? Seems to fix the problem for me, but I'm not sure if it's a real solution or more of a workaround. I sent an MR to your repo anyway :)